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 bpf-next 9/9] selftests/bpf: add batch ops testing to array bpf map

On 11/21/19 1:14 PM, Brian Vazquez wrote:
> Thanks for reviewing it!
> 
> On Thu, Nov 21, 2019 at 10:43 AM Yonghong Song <yhs@fb.com> wrote:
>>
>>
>>
>> On 11/19/19 11:30 AM, Brian Vazquez wrote:
>>> Tested bpf_map_lookup_batch() and bpf_map_update_batch()
>>> functionality.
>>>
>>>     $ ./test_maps
>>>         ...
>>>           test_map_lookup_and_delete_batch_array:PASS
>>>         ...
>>
>> The test is for lookup_batch() and update_batch()
>> and the test name and func name is lookup_and_delete_batch(),
>> probably rename is to lookup_and_update_batch_array()?
>>
> Yes, you are right, I will change the name for next version.
> 
>> It would be good if generic lookup_and_delete_batch()
>> and delete_patch() can be tested as well.
>> Maybe tried to use prog_array?
> 
>   I did test generic_lookup_and_delete_batch with hmap and it worked
> fine because I didn't have concurrent deletions.
> But yes I will add tests for generic delete and lookup_and_delete,
> maybe for the trie map (prog_array doesn't support lookup ang hence
> lookup_and_delete won't apply there)?

trie_map is a good choice. Basically any map which can be used to test
this API.
